Clogged Gutter Clearing in Bergen County, NJ
Clogged gutter clearing services involve removing deb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t that can obstruct the flow of water through a property's gutter system. This service covers a variety of projects, including routine maintenance for residential homes, preparation for seasonal storms, and addressing specific blockages that cause water overflow or damage. Homeowners often seek gutter clearing to prevent water from pooling around the foundation, causing potential structural issues, or to avoid water damage to siding and landscaping.
Before requesting gutter clearing,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the clogging, the condition of their gutter system, and whether additional repairs might be necessary. It’s also helpful to know if the project involves cleaning downspouts, inspecting for damage, or installing guards to reduce future blockages. Clear communication about the property’s gutter layout and any specific concerns can ensure the service addresses the unique needs of each home effectively.

Clogged Gutter Clearing Questions
What causes gutter clogs? Leaves, twigs, and debris often block gutters, especially during fall or after storms.
How can clogged gutters affect a property? They can lead to water damage, foundation issues, and roof leaks if not cleared.
What are common signs of a clogged gutter? Overflowing water, sagging gutters, and stained fascia boards are typical indicators.
Is gutter clearing necessary before winter? Yes, removing debris helps prevent ice dams and water backup during cold weather.
